Best Sceneries As You Sail From Panama To Colombia By Boat

Sailing from the Central to South American region provides an alternative route for many given that it is impossible to travel overland. Primarily, this arises from the risk posed by guerrillas operating along the unmarked forest. Similarly, the region is home to poisonous snakes alongside the scaring jaguars. Although taking flights to provides a convincing platform guaranteeing arrival, the high costs offers a deterrence barrier for many. For this reason, assuming the sailing excursion proves a prudent decision for most travelers.

For them taking a boat trip offers them admissible description of the navigation course. Completing the boat tour to the South American region from Panama involves a five-day pleasure trip. This mandates the sailors execute prepared navigation by implementing precautions to avoid exposure to the controllable risks.

Alike other sea travel, avoiding seasickness would top the checklist for the usual victims of motion sickness. Postponing the trip till the rainy season when likely to experience lower winds would resolve this issue. Alternatively, receiving anti-seasickness treatments would curb the situation before attaining the full-blown status. Additionally, restricting ones feeding to light rather than large greasy meals would prevent the condition.

Conducting safety meetings presents an opportunity where the sailors brief the travelers essential information before departure. At this point, all bags are organized and stored to create more space for all aboard the vessel. This will facilitate an environment where all will enjoy the night breeze since most trips start in the late hours for travelers to experience the beautiful scenery of San Blas Islands in the morning.

During the second day, the travelers would spend the time to stroll the islands, thus deriving unique experience from the coral gardens. A similar encounter with the golden beach generates a lasting impression that they would never realize in other modes of transport. Finally, the natural glimpse of reefs submerging the sun rays provides a spectacular view of the sunset.

Day four would mainly present the last day spent in San Blas. The sailors would ensure all backpackers receive their dinner before setting off towards Cartagena. This would stretch to day five that presents the hardest stage of the trip with seasickness. Although the weather is unpredictable at this stage, calm conditions would offer an ideal environment for playing games and watching. Unless the weather conditions affect the schedule, the boat would reach Cartagena by lunchtime of day six.
